Increase your gas mileage by up to 27+%....

I've received this in my Hotmail account two times already so that means it has got to be the real deal

It is the latest and the greatest thing since the infamous Tornado Fuel Saver but this is "proven" technology:
"A certified U.S.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) laboratory recently completed tests on the new Fuel Saver. The results were astounding!..."



It's called the Fuel Saver Pro This revolutionary technology [a 2 word term for gimmic] It is a MATCHED PAIR of tuned custom sealed Neodymium Super inductors (sounds like magnets to me) that generate a frequency resonance between its two faces and it works on a molecular level to break up the hydrocarbons in the fuel. You install it in seconds by putting it over your fuel line and presto - the magic begins.


This would be the greatest thing unless it mentioned something about horsepower which it will boost by 10%.


It can be yours today for 89.95 + s/h. Act today to and you will see results 1,500 miles after its installation.






I just wanted to poke fun at this because I was suckered by the Tornado...
